Blue Prism components
- [Narrator] Blue Prism can be considered to consist of three main components which, linked together, represent an automated process. It's very important to understand the functionality and structure of each of them before you move on to the actual configuration. So, the three main components of Blue Prism are Object Layer, Application Modeller, and Process Layer. The interface to the Application is contained within the Object Layer. The Business Object can be found under the Studio's tab and it consists of functionalities which are created and performed against one Application. It's very important to remember that one Business Object can be configured to only one Application at a time, which means you have an Object for an Application. The number of functionalities which are required for the automated process tend to be quite large and it might be easier to split them into multiple Objects by the functionality they perform or the screen they use.
